Dana White Says He Knows Joshua-Fury Venue, Points to Turki’s Peace Summit

Dana White says he already knows where the long-awaited Anthony Joshua vs. Tyson Fury fight will take place, but he isn’t ready to reveal the location.

“I have all the info,” White said last Sunday night at the Jose “Rayo” Valenzuela vs. Edwin De Los Santos 2 post-fight press conference in Las Vegas when asked about the heavyweight showdown.

Asked if he would be promoting the fight, White replied, “See what Turki [Alalshikh] says at the peace summit. Like I told you guys. I know where it is. And never did I say Las Vegas.”

White’s comments suggest the plans for one of boxing’s biggest potential fights are already well advanced, even if an official announcement has yet to be made. Rumors have linked the bout to several locations in recent months, with Las Vegas frequently mentioned as a possible destination. White, however, made it clear he has never identified the Nevada city as the host.

Joshua and Fury have discussed fighting each other for years, but the long-awaited showdown has never been finalized.

Turki Alalshikh has made the fight one of his top priorities and has previously indicated that discussions are ongoing. White’s reference to the upcoming peace summit suggests a formal announcement could come once Alalshikh addresses the media.

White also declined to confirm whether Zuffa Boxing will officially promote the event, instead directing attention back to Alalshikh’s expected announcement. Since launching Zuffa Boxing, White has repeatedly stated that his company intends to become a major player in the sport while working alongside Alalshikh on select events.

If Joshua vs. Fury is finalized, it would rank among the biggest heavyweight attractions of the modern era. Both former champions remain two of boxing’s biggest commercial draws, and a long-awaited meeting between them has been one of the sport’s most anticipated matchups for nearly a decade.
